Why Your Cat Needs a Quality Carrier

Getting a good cat carrier is key for your pet’s safety and comfort when you travel. It keeps them safe and sound, reducing the chance of injury or escape.

Safety Benefits During Transport

A strong, well-ventilated cat carrier keeps your pet safe on the move. It stops them from being tossed around or getting out.

It also helps spread out the shock of sudden stops or turns. This lessens the chance of your cat getting hurt.

Reducing Travel Anxiety

A quality cat carrier can make your cat feel better about traveling. It gives them a cozy, known space. Covering the carrier with a light blanket can also calm them down by hiding outside noises.

Putting in your cat’s favourite toy or a piece of your clothing can also offer comfort. It makes them feel more secure.

Choosing the Right Size Cat Carrier

The size of a cat carrier is crucial for your cat’s comfort and to reduce stress. A carrier that’s too small can be uncomfortable. On the other hand, a carrier that’s too big might not offer the security your cat needs.

How to Measure Your Cat Properly

To find the perfect cat carrier size, start by measuring your cat accurately. Measure from the tip of their nose to the base of their tail. Then, measure their height from the top of their head to their paws when standing.

Lastly, measure their girth around the widest part of their body. These measurements will guide you in picking the right carrier size. Remember, your cat should be able to stand up, turn around, and lie down comfortably inside.

Space Requirements for Comfortable Travel

The ideal cat carrier should offer enough space for your cat to move around. Experts suggest choosing a carrier that’s at least 1.5 times your cat’s length. This ensures there’s enough room for your cat’s natural movements during travel.

Best Carriers for Vet Visits

For vet visits, a carrier that’s easy to clean and well-ventilated is best. Hard-sided plastic carriers are great because they’re durable and easy to clean. They should also have secure locks to keep your cat safe.

Carriers with removable tops or sides are also good. They make it easier to get your cat out or give them medicine.

Options for Long Car Journeys

For long car trips, comfort is crucial. Soft-sided fabric carriers are more comfortable for your cat. They offer flexibility and cushioning. Make sure the carrier is well-ventilated and has a sturdy base.

Look for carriers with padded interiors, mesh windows, and multiple entry points. These features make travel easier for your cat.

Airline-Approved Carriers for Flights

If you’re flying with your cat, you need an airline-approved carrier. These carriers meet size, ventilation, and safety standards. Always check with your airline before buying.

Airline-approved carriers are usually hard-sided and well-ventilated. Some even have wheels for easier airport travel.

Training Your Cat to Accept Their Carrier

Getting your cat to like their carrier takes time, patience, and a gentle approach. Cats often see carriers as scary. But, with the right steps, you can make it a safe and welcoming place for them.

Gradual Introduction Techniques

Start by introducing the carrier slowly. Place it in a room where your cat likes to hang out. Make sure the door is open so they can explore at their own pace. You can put treats or toys inside to make it more appealing.

When your cat feels comfortable going inside, start closing the door while you’re there. Begin with short times and slowly increase it. This helps them get used to being in a closed space without feeling scared or trapped.

Creating Positive Carrier Associations

It’s important to make the carrier a positive place for your cat. Feed them near or inside the carrier to make it a good experience. Using pheromone sprays or calming treats can also help them relax when in the carrier.

Remember, being consistent and patient is key. Over time, your cat will see the carrier as a positive thing. This will make traveling easier for both of you.

Keeping your cat carrier clean is key for your pet’s health. A clean carrier stops diseases and makes travel easier for your cat. We’ll talk about the need for regular cleaning and deep cleaning after accidents or illness.

It’s important to clean your cat carrier often. Remove bedding and toys and wash them separately. Use mild detergent and warm water to clean the carrier’s surfaces. Focus on stains or dirt buildup.

Regular Cleaning Routines

To keep your cat carrier clean, have a regular cleaning plan. This includes:

  • Wipe down the carrier with a damp cloth after each use
  • Wash any removable parts, such as bedding or mats, weekly
  • Inspect the carrier regularly for signs of wear and tear

For fabric parts, use a gentle fabric cleaner. Hard-sided carriers can be cleaned with mild soap solution. Make sure all parts are dry before putting them back together.

Deep Cleaning After Accidents or Illness

If your cat has an accident or gets sick while traveling, you’ll need to deep clean the carrier. Use a pet-safe disinfectant and follow the instructions. Focus on areas where your cat’s waste or bodily fluids touched.

Summer Heat Safety Measures

In summer, it’s crucial to prevent your cat from getting too hot. Make sure their carrier has good airflow. Also, never leave your cat in a parked car, as it can get very dangerous.

Tips for Summer Travel:

  • Travel during cooler times, like early morning or evening.
  • Keep your car well-ventilated or use air conditioning.
  • Provide water to keep your cat hydrated.

Winter Cold Protection Tips

In winter, cold can be a risk for your cat’s health. Use a carrier that keeps warm and cover it with a blanket. Also, warm up your car before taking your cat out to avoid cold air blasts.
